<p><span style="font-weight: normal;"><span style="font-style: normal;">Under the Hood was </span></span><a href="http://www.statesman.com/news/content/news/stories/local/2009/08/15/0815hoodcafe.html"><span style="font-weight: normal;"><span style="font-style: normal;">opened earlier this  year</span></span></a><span style="font-weight: normal;"><span style="font-style: normal;"> in Killeen, about a mile from Fort Hood, as a joint effort of the terrorist support groups Code Pink and Iraq Veterans Against the War (both groups participated in the </span></span><a href="http://www.worldproutassembly.org/archives/2005/09/declaration_of_2.html%22"><span style="font-weight: normal;"><span style="font-style: normal;">World Tribunal on Iraq</span></span></a><span style="font-weight: normal;"><span style="font-style: normal;"> which openly supported the terrorists in Iraq.) The cafe is run by the wife and step-mother of servicemen, Cynthia Thomas, whom </span></span><a href="http://codepink4peace.org/blog/2009/11/why-i-started-under-the-hood-in-killeen-tx/"><span style="font-weight: normal;"><span style="font-style: normal;">Code Pink took under their wings</span></span></a><span style="font-weight: normal;"><span style="font-style: normal;">. </span></span></p>
<p><span style="font-weight: normal;"><span style="font-style: normal;">The cafe is a reprise of pro-communist efforts during the Vietnam War to undermine morale on the homefront by exploiting the vulnerabilities of soldiers and their families with subversive cafes opened near military bases across the country. </span></span></p>
<p><span style="font-weight: normal;"><span style="font-style: normal;">Reportedly Fort Lewis and Fort Drum have also been targeted with subversive cafes in recent years. </span></span></p>
<p><span style="font-weight: normal;"><span style="font-style: normal;"> The name of the coffee shop, Under the Hood, is a wordplay on the subversive nature of the effort in Killeen. </span></span></p>
